This weekend, Ferrari will celebrate 1,000 races in F1, having made their debut at the 1950 Monaco Grand Prix. In the intervening years they've won 239 races, 16 constructors' titles and 15 drivers' championships – but how did they become such a force?
In this video, we uncover the origins of F1's most famous team, from Enzo Ferrari's racing roots to the design of their iconic Prancing Horse badge. It's a tale of power, passion and emotion – and not to be missed!
